Over in our pages section, a white paper (a dark blue paper?) on a method for making text wrap nicely around an irregularly shaped image, just like in print. Unlike other methods that require hand-slicing your image and creating divs to measure the width, this does it automatically using an Ajax call to a Perl script, and some further javascript processing to make it all happen behind the scenes.
